🟡 Medium Priority
变更行:Ascend910_9363.ini diff 第 122 行,
25=Intrinsic_mmad|u32u8u8,s32s8s8,s32u8s8,f16f16f16,f32f16f16,f16f16u2,u8,s8,f162f16,f162f32,f16u2,u8s8受影响的行为/契约:
[AICoreintrinsicDtypeMap]中Intrinsic_mmad(矩阵乘加)内在函数的数据类型映射表缺少,h322f32,f32f32f32,f322f32三种类型组合(半精度→float32 累加、纯 float32、float32→float32)。失败模式:9363 与 9362 共享相同的 AIC 版本(AIC-C-220)和架构参数。在同系列所有其他芯片配置(9362、9372、9381、9382、9391、9392)的
[AICoreintrinsicDtypeMap]中,25=Intrinsic_mmad均包含尾部的,h322f32,f32f32f32,f322f32。缺少这些类型组合将导致编译器无法为这些常见精度组合生成正确的矩阵乘加指令,可能引起编译失败或运行时精度回退。注意:workspace 中该文件已被修正,此处报告的是 diff 版本中的问题。
建议:将第 122 行改为在末尾追加
,h322f32,f32f32f32,f322f32,与 9362 及所有其他 93xx 系列芯片配置保持一致。
